®The Center for Professional Innovation & Education (CfPIE) is accredited by the Accreditation Council for Pharmacy Education as a provider of continuing pharmacy education. ACPE was established in 1932 and is the national accrediting agency in pharmacy recognized by the Secretary of Education, U.S. Department of Education. The ACPE Continuing Education Provider Accreditation Program assures pharmacists of the quality of continuing pharmaceutical education programs. The accreditation process involves review and evaluation of providers that is both retrospective and prospective in nature. Providers seeking accreditation are measured against the Criteria for Quality which serves as the Council’s standards of quality for continuing educational activities. An Accreditation Provider may be awarded up to a six-year term of approval based upon ongoing monitoring to assure the maintenance of quality and strengthening in accord with Council expectations. Renewal of accreditation is based upon periodic petitions for continued approval. Among monitoring techniques utilized are participant surveys, provider self-assessment, in-depth review of selected educational activities, and third-party/peer review. The American Society for Quality (ASQ) is the world's leading authority on quality. With more than 95,000 individual and organizational members, this professional association advances learning, quality improvement, and knowledge exchange to improve business results, and to create better workplaces and communities worldwide. As champion of the quality movement, ASQ offers technologies, concepts, tools, and training to quality professionals, quality practitioners, and everyday consumers, encouraging all to Make Good Great®. Since 1991 ASQ has administered the United States’ premier quality honor— the Malcolm Baldrige National Quality Award, which annually recognizes companies and organizations that have achieved performance excellence. ASQ offers 14 certification programs: Certified Quality Engineer, Certified Quality Auditor, Certified Manager of Quality Organizational Excellence, Certified Software Quality Engineer, Certified Reliability Engineer, Certified Quality Technician, Certified Quality Inspector, Six Sigma Black Belt, Six Sigma Green Belt, Certified HACCP Auditor, Certified Biomedical Auditor, Certified Calibration Technician, Certified Quality Improvement Associate, Certified Quality Process Analyst.
